In order to heal your back you have to educate yourself and then you have to make an effort every day to achieve a new level of health. Here are the most important ways to heal your back that I know.
1. If you are injured you need to rest. You also need to apply ice. Give it time to heal before you start in with any exercise routine. When you are ready then start gently with mild stretching and massage.
2. Learn how to stretch your body. This is also called yoga. It takes time and effort to learn how to stretch. Buy books, watch videos, go to classes. Then take time to stretch every day. This is not optional!
3. Get massage. Massage releases tension from tight muscles that are impinging on nerves. Massage is an incredible healing tool that everyone should receive on a regular basis. If you can’t afford massage then arrange to trade with someone. Also, self massage is very important. Do self massage daily!

5. Strengthen your muscles with exercise. Go to a local gym. Walk every day. Do crunches. You are in charge of your own life! Health care is 99% on YOU…not a doctor!

Keep your sacrum (tail bone) pressed right into the corner of your seat.
7. Get your work UP. Don’t look down all the time! Get your computer, book, knitting or whatever UP so that you don’t have to look down.
8. Take regular breaks. Slow down and take time to rest and recover.

10. De-stress. The more wound the mind, the tighter the back. Stress is the biggest factor in most illness. Take time to do breathing exercises, meditate, reflect and don’t sweat the small stuff.
